Mastercard recently partnered with Bakkt, a digital asset platform, to help banks, merchants and fintechs deliver cryptocurrency solutions. The companies will offer crypto-as-service through the Mastercard network and Bakkt's digital asset platform, according to a press release.
Mastercard customers can buy, sell and hold digital assets through wallets on the Bakkt platform, as well as access crypto debit and credit cards. Customers will also be able to earn cryptocurrency as rewards on Mastercard's loyalty solutions.
